Hello, I'm restoring a 67 convertible, doing the wiring with new harnesses from American Autowire. I have the power top working correctly and the 30 amp breaker on the firewall. All factory parts.
I have the power windows set up as in all wired at switches, motors, circuit breaker under dash driver's side. There is a 3 prong harness connector that plugs into the breaker.
This leaves empty 2 spades from the breaker unaccounted for wiring.
I'm guessing the under dash breaker needs to get power  (?) from somewhere and I need an accessory harness.
I have looked everywhere for information without success.
Any help would be appreciated

I found the aftermarket breaker from the parts supply store was too generic. Original only had 3 prong connectors on it. I followed the wiring diagram. 1 has 12 volt power, 1 feeds the power windows, 1 has power when ignition is switched on. The power from the 30 amp breaker on the firewall splits into 2 power feeds. One for the power top. One for power windows. The power top switch functions without the ignition on and the power windows require ignition on to make the windows function. Probably a safety feature. Problem solved. Incorrect aftermarket relay. Thanks
